Exported catalog from a 32-bit DB2 source and now importing to a 64-bit DB2 target client, however now not able to add or edit or delete any catalog entries into Toad for DB2; nothing happens after a successful add message.
Performing a List Database Directory command in the Command line (CLP), it's different from what is shown in the catalog in Toad for DB2.
WORKAROUND:
1. Launch Toad, close the connection Window.
2. Go to Help | About, click on the Application Data Directory link to open that path.
3. On the Help page, click on the Application Directory link to open that path.
4. Close Toad, but keep the two Windows Explorer paths open.
5. Uninstall Toad for DB via the Control Panel in the Add\Remove Programs.
6. After the uninstall, the two directories will remain; delete them.
7. Re-install Toad. The catalog should be empty.
Do not import any catalogs, rather add catalogs using the wizard which will function properly now.
